A Detailed Examination of Nursing Home Costs Across the U.S.
Nursing home care costs in the U.S. vary significantly based on location, level of care, and amenities, with private room prices ranging from approximately $6,700 to over $30,000 monthly. Families need to explore various payment options and conduct thorough research to manage these expenses effectively.
Exploring Nonmedical Home Care: Understanding Services, Costs, and Financial Approaches
Nonmedical home care provides assistance with daily activities and companionship for individuals wishing to maintain independence and quality of life at home, without medical intervention. Its growing popularity is driven by an aging population, the need for supportive environments for recovery, and the emotional benefits of caregiver companionship, while costs vary based on service frequency and location.
Engaging Brain Games and Innovative Apps to Keep Senior Minds Active
Maintaining cognitive fitness through engaging in various brain games, both traditional and digital, is crucial for seniors as it enhances memory retention, problem-solving abilities, and emotional well-being while helping to protect against age-related decline. A holistic approach that includes diverse activities, physical exercise, a balanced diet, and social interaction further supports mental health and cognitive function.
